Australian households brace for potential grocery price hikes as diesel prices soar, threatening transportation costs and food supply. Prime Minister Anthony Albanese and state premiers prepare for a national cabinet meeting to address surging petrol and diesel demand. Business groups urge a reduction in heavy vehicle road user charges to alleviate freight hauler costs. Supermarket giants like Coles and Woolworths adjust fuel levies for truck drivers, while global oil prices surge amid Middle East conflict fears. National cabinet explores options to stabilize diesel supply and protect jobs.
